小编Ugo*_*Lfe的帖子

使用brew在MacOS上安装php72

我正在尝试使用brew安装php72。

实际上,我brew install php72下载的是“ https://homebrew.bintray.com/bottles/php-7.3.0.mojave.bottle.tar.gz ”。

因此,当我检查php版本时,将向我显示PHP 7.3.0(cli)。

我如何才能完全安装php72而不是php73?

php homebrew php-7.2 php-7.3

5
推荐指数
1
解决办法
4776
查看次数

使用 rollup 编译 React 组件返回 webpack 错误

我正在尝试通过 Rollup.js 编译 React jsx 组件来填充 commonjs 中的组件库。

这是我的汇总配置

import peerDepsExternal from 'rollup-plugin-peer-deps-external';
import resolve from '@rollup/plugin-node-resolve';
import babel from '@rollup/plugin-babel';
import commonjs from '@rollup/plugin-commonjs';
import postcss from 'rollup-plugin-postcss';
import image from '@rollup/plugin-image';
import json from '@rollup/plugin-json';

export default {
  input: ['./src/xxx.jsx'],
  output: [
    {
      dir: './public/build/lib/xxx/commonjs/',
      format: 'esm',
      sourcemap: true,
    },
  ],
  plugins: [
    peerDepsExternal(),
    resolve({
      browser: true,
      preferBuiltins: false,
      extensions: ['.mjs', '.js', '.json', '.node', '.jsx', '.ts', '.tsx'],
    }),
    babel({
      exclude: './node_modules/**',
      presets: ['@babel/preset-env', '@babel/preset-react'],
      plugins: ['@babel/plugin-transform-runtime'],
      babelHelpers: 'runtime', …
Run Code Online (Sandbox Code Playgroud)

jsx node.js reactjs webpack rollupjs

5
推荐指数
1
解决办法
4249
查看次数

标签 统计

homebrew ×1

jsx ×1

node.js ×1

php ×1

php-7.2 ×1

php-7.3 ×1

reactjs ×1

rollupjs ×1

webpack ×1